The Incident
On August 23, 2025, Zong, a 29-year-old permanent resident of Singapore, was caught speeding at an alarming rate of 121kmh on West Coast Highway, where the speed limit is a mere 70kmh. This significant breach of the law led to a court appearance, where Zong pleaded guilty to the charge of speeding.
The Verdict
The court's decision was twofold: a fine of S$800 and a one-month driving ban. Prior Offenses
What makes this case particularly intriguing is Zong's history of traffic violations. With three prior speeding offenses in April 2020, June 2020, and September 2023, it raises questions about the actor's attitude towards road safety and the effectiveness of previous penalties. The court's decision to impose a driving ban, despite the prosecutor's initial stance, suggests a need for a stricter approach to deter repeat offenders.
